§ 5-2-44 SUMMARY ABATEMENT BY CITY WHEN EMERGENCY OR ON PUBLIC PROPERTY.
   Whenever any nuisance:
   (A)   Constitutes or is deemed to be an imminent or immediate danger to public health or safety; or
   (B)   Exists on public property, the proper city officer shall cause such nuisance to be summarily and immediately abated and removed, regardless of any 48-hour or other time period specified by notice to the person responsible therefor; provided, however that in division (A) above, such officer shall have first applied for and obtained the written permission of the Mayor for such summary abatement.
(1974 Code, § 5-5-3.5)
